High competition, fair play and sportsmanship have kept the Staten Island Basketball League chugging along all these years


The league, which was founded by Islander Craig Raucher in 1980, recently turned 43 years old and has played all these years at PS 8 in Great Kills, which at age 85 is one of the oldest public schools on the Island.
